1Left 4 Dead 2 - Set in the zombie apocalypse, Left 4 Dead 2 is a co-operative action horror FPS takes you and your friends through the cities, swamps and cemeteries of the Deep South, from Savannah to New Orleans across five expansive campaigns.
Nov 16, 2009
In this game, you can…
- play as the infected in multiplayer, coordinating ambushes and hunting your friends as special monsters.
- have a giant brute show up mid-fight and start throwing cars at you in the middle of your escape route.
- run the same campaign twice and get different enemy spawns, item placement, lighting, and even weather, changing every fight and route.
- rip through a crowd with a chainsaw, then swap to a frying pan and keep clearing zombies up close.
- get grabbed by a long tongue and dragged around a corner while your team has to sprint after you.
- startle a crying witch, and she instantly mauls the nearest survivor.
- get vomited on, and it immediately calls a horde straight onto your whole team.
- race to fill a generator with gas cans while the other team tries to stop you, turning the match into a frantic objective sprint.

3Dying Light - First-person action survival game set in a post-apocalyptic open world overrun by flesh-hungry zombies. Roam a city devastated by a mysterious virus epidemic. Scavenge for supplies, craft weapons, and face hordes of the infected.
Jan 26, 2015
In this game, you can…
- swing across the skyline with a grappling hook that opens up entirely new routes.
- outrun night hunters, flash an ultraviolet light to buy seconds, then hide in a pipe until the chase ends.
- dropkick enemies off rooftops so they ragdoll down six-story drops.
- chain parkour into kills by vaulting a zombie and instantly drop-attacking for a finisher.
- turn the city into a weapon by luring zombies into spikes, fires, and exploding barrels.
- risk going out at night for bigger rewards, then sprint safehouse-to-safehouse when the world flips into hunt mode.
- craft melee weapons with elemental effects that set zombies on fire or shock them on hit.
- join a friend in co-op and race rooftops together, turning escapes into shared, chaotic near-misses.

10Plants vs. Zombies GOTY Edition - Zombies are invading your home, and the only defense is your arsenal of plants! Armed with an alien nursery-worth of zombie-zapping plants like peashooters and cherry bombs, you'll need to think fast and plant faster to stop dozens of types of zombies dead in their tracks.
May 5, 2009
In this game, you can…
- play a mode where you control the zombies, choose your horde, and break through cardboard plants to eat the brains.
- create your own custom zombie and sometimes see it wandering around in the actual attacking hordes.
- beat the final boss, then watch the zombies you fought all game perform a full ending music video together.
- plant sunflowers to generate sun, then spend it to build a defensive lineup before the next wave reaches your house.
- fight on lawns that turn into night fog, pool lanes, and a rooftop, forcing you to rethink where every plant goes.
- drop a cherry bomb to instantly erase a packed lane and flip a losing wave into a win.
- replay the whole campaign with the full plant roster, but have three of your plant picks randomly chosen for you.
- smash open vases to reveal hidden plants and zombies, then rebuild your defense on the fly based on what you found.
